What is the difference between paid and free Zoom?

Zoom free license gives you unlimited time for individual meetings, but group meetings are limited to 40 minutes with up to 100 video participants. A free license also allows for screen sharing. Zoom Pro (paid) gets you unlimited group meetings, a personalized meeting ID, and access to add-ons like Zoom Webinars, Zoom Rooms, Cloud Room Connector, etc.

What happens if I go over 40 minutes on Zoom?

After 40 minutes, the meeting will end, in this case users can restart the meeting after waiting 1 minute by clicking the same meeting link or starting a new meeting.

Do I need an account to attend a Zoom meeting?

No, you do not need an account to attend a Zoom meeting. However, if you want to host a meeting, you must first sign up for an account.

Is Zoom secure?

By default, free and paid Zoom accounts use 256-bit AES encryption to share audio, video, and application sharing. Right now, Zoom also offers End-to-End Encryption (E2EE) as a technical preview, though enabling this setting also disables some features.

Can I record a meeting with Zoom?

Yes, you can record meetings on your local device with a free license. Pro accounts add 1GB storage for cloud recording.

What are the best Zoom alternatives?

There are several Zoom alternatives, some of them include free plans to host meetings like Google Meet, Cisco Webex, Skype, and MS Teams.

Focus Mode

In focus mode, only the host can see participants' videos and profile pictures. You can start Focus Mode from the "More" menu on the toolbar of the desktop client. This setting is available at the account-, group-, and user-level settings pages. This requires the desktop client for Windows or macOS version 5.7.3 or higher.

Meeting features

  • Interpreter exemption to host preventing participants from unmuting - Windows, macOS, Linux
  • Host designated interpreters will be able to unmute themselves even when the host prevents participants from unmuting themselves. Previously, all participants in a meeting, except for the host and co-host, were blocked from unmuting if the host prevented unmuting through the in-meeting security controls.
  • Continuous Meeting Chat file and images synchronization - Windows, macOS, Linux, Android, iOS
  • Files and images shared during the meeting synchronize with the dedicated group chat created for the meeting, allowing participants to access them after the meeting. In the same fashion, files and images shared in the dedicated meeting group chat will synchronize with in-meeting chat. This feature will not be immediately available, as it is dependent on a backend server update currently scheduled for May 8, 2023.
  • Zoom IQ Meeting Summary - Windows, macOS, Linux, Android, iOS
  • Users can enable this feature to take advantage of the wealth of information generated in meetings. After enabling on the web portal, the smart summary will create transcripts of your meetings, including next steps for participants. All meeting participants will be notified that the summary is being generated, and the meeting host can stop the smart summary at any time, if necessary.

Webinar features

  • Webinar automated and translated captions enhancements - Windows, macOS, Linux, Android, iOS
  • Translated captions in webinars are enhanced to make it simpler for attendees while providing hosts with greater control before the webinar starts. Hosts can set their own speaking language, as well as the speaking language of the webinar and of each panelist, before the webinars starts. To avoid confusion, webinar attendees will have the speaking language option removed from their controls, but can still choose the language they want captions translated to if translated captions are available in the webinar.
  • Webinar Resources - Speakers details - Windows, macOS, Linux, Android, iOS
  • Webinar hosts can also add information about their speakers, which will appear in the Resources tab during the live webinar. Information such as name, profile picture, job title, company details, biography, and links to social media can be provided.
